I've been living in Randallstown, Maryland, for a couple years now due to my job. It's a fairly small city, with a few areas it could improve on. The downtown area has a basic bus system which will get you around just the central part of the city, which is also where most of the ...Read More
stores are located. Having your own vehicle will certainly make it easier for you.
The crime in Randallstown is something you'll want to keep in the back of your mind, as it's quite higher than the state average. As such, the cost of living and real estate prices are both lower below average. In the summer, the weather is comfortable but a few days may break the triple-digit mark.
For me, one of the best areas in Randallstown was Wildwood Park. I spent many afternoons there with my dog and it's overall a very enjoyable place to get some fresh air and socialize.
